Learn how to perform internal and external audits of an environmental management system (EMS) against the requirements of ISO 14001 with this CQI and IRCA certified ISO 14001 Lead Auditor training course.
|
The course give delegates the skills and confidence to plan, conduct, report and follow up EMS audits. By the end of the course attendees will be able to:
|
- audit to assess conformance with ISO 14001 requirements
- identify whether the EMS is effectively implemented and maintained
- contribute to the continual improvement of the EMS
The course is built around a central case study that simulates a site audit, giving students practical experience in tackling audit tasks. Workshops, discussions and interactive tutorials cover important topics such as risk-based auditing, assessing environmental aspects and impacts, and EMS nonconformity writing.

Full attendance is required during the training course.
|
The Learner is assessed during course delivery based on participation and performance throughout the duration of the course. This includes all exercises, role plays, case study and all other activities during the course.
|
There is a two-hour EMS Auditor Examination at the end of the course.
|
|
*Successful completion of this EMS ISO 14001:2015 Lead Auditor course will satisfy the training requirements for IRCA certification to all grades of Environmental Management System Auditor.
